Hi Hono developers.
We, the Eclipse Ditto team, just released our milestone 0.3.0-M1 in which we stabilized the connectivity to Hono.
See also our blog posts about that if you are interested:
·
https://www.eclipse.org/ditto/2018-04-25-connectivity-service.html
·
https://www.eclipse.org/ditto/2018-04-26-milestone-announcement-030-M1.html
What do you think about connecting our two sandboxes to demonstrate Hono and Ditto working together?
We are already connecting the commercial Bosch services in our commercial Bosch IoT Suite setup, so it should not be a problem to do the same in the sandboxes.
With Ditto’s _javascript_ based payload mapping feature the south-bound device must no longer send in Ditto protocol, we can create a connection which maps some arbitrary JSON
to a format Ditto can understand.
